Krishna Byre Gowda blasts Union Minister M Venkaiah Naidu

Published On : 24 Jun 2017   |  Reported By : Canaranews Network


Udupi: Krishna Byre Gowda, Minister for Agriculture slammed Union Minister M Venkaiah Naidu for his statement against the farmers demanding loan waiver. He said that the monetary burden on cultivators is an outcome of the Centre failing to full fill its promise of waiving the loan of nationalised banks made by the farmers. He was speaking after inaugurating the Agriculture Diploma College at Brahmavar on Friday.

"Naidu’s statement is unfortunate and said that his statement has insulted the farmers. Such statements by ministers on farm loan waiver shows their attitude towards the poor farmers. This remark is an insult to them. The state government has given many incentives to farmers directly and indirectly. For instance, the energy bill that the government pays on behalf of the farmers is close to Rs 9000 crore per year. Many other states charge the farmers for electricity, whereas in Karnataka, the government pays on behalf of the farmers” he added.


BJP state president B S Yeddyurappa’s statement that after BJP’s demand and protest the government waived the loan of farmers. then why is BSY is not ready to convince Narendra Modi to waive the farm loans. No BJP MP’s has voiced their opinion in front of the Prime Minister. Yeddyurappa has double standards when it comes to the farmer’s issue. Recalling Yeddyurappa’s tenure as chief minister, the minister said that, “When Congress asked Yeddyurappa, the then chief minister, to waive off farm loans in the Legislative Council, Yeddyurappa said that he did not have a note printing machine. The document is available in the Council. Yeddyurappa is a liar and is making false and baseless allegations against the state government for political gains. BJP MPs have not raised their voice on the farm loan waiver in the Parliament, he added.
